ChatGPTで学ぶkubernetes:minikubeよりも簡単にmacでkubernetesを動かすツールを教えて
ChatGPTで学ぶkubernetes:minikubeよりも簡単にmacでkubernetesを動かすツールを教えて

minikubeよりも簡単にmacでkubernetesを動かすツールはありますか?類似のツールを列挙してください
(略)Minikubeは、初心者が使用するとなかなか複雑なツールであると言えます。また、Hypervisorをインストールすることも必要になるため、Mac上でKubernetesを動かすためには、一定の作業が必要になります。
そのため、Minikubeよりも簡単にMac上でKubernetesを動かすことができるツールもあります。代表的なものをいくつか紹介します。
Docker for Mac: Docker for Macは、Mac上でDockerを実行するためのツールです。Docker for Macは、Mac上でKubernetesを動かすこともできます。Docker for Macを使用することで、KubernetesをMac上で簡単に動かすことができます。
おー、自分が思っていたのはこれだ

MicroK8s: MicroK8sは、Ubuntu上でKubernetesを動かすためのツールです。MicroK8sは、Mac上でも動作するため、Mac上でKubernetesを動かすことができます。MicroK8sを使用することで、KubernetesをMac上で簡単に動かすことができます。
以上のように、Minikubeよりも簡単にMac上でKubernetesを動かすことができるツールもあります。Docker for MacやMicroK8sなどがそのようなツールです。お好みのツールを使用することで、Mac上でKubernetesを動かすことができます。
docker for macでkubernetesを動かすサンプルコードを教えてください
(略)Docker for MacのUIから、Kubernetesを有効にします。Kubernetesを有効にすると、KubernetesがDocker for Mac上で動作するようになります。
誘導尋問に乗らないな(コードで有効化するものではない)

最後に、Kubernetesを動かすためのコマンドを実行します。例えば、以下のようなコマンドを実行することで、Kubernetesを動かすことができます。
説明が雑だな、Kubernetesはもう動いているので、以下はKubernetes上でWebサーバを動かす方法ですね

確かに

zsh$ kubectl create deployment hello-world --image=nginx:1.7.9
$ kubectl expose deployment hello-world --port=80 --type=LoadBalancer

上のコードは何をやっていますか?説明してください
まず、 kubectl create deployment hello-world --image=nginx:1.7.9
というコマンドを実行しています。
やけにnginxのバージョンが古いのが気になる・・、間違いではないが・・

まぁでもAIはこういう時に最新版を伝えるべき、みたいな知識はないか・・
例として多く知っているものを出してそう
このコマンドは、Kubernetes上にhello-worldという名前のデプロイメントを作成するためのコマンドです。このコマンドを実行すると、hello-worldという名前のデプロイメントが作成されます。
次に、 kubectl expose deployment hello-world --port=80 --type=LoadBalancer
というコマンドを実行しています。
このコマンドは、hello-worldという名前のデプロイメントを、外部からアクセス可能なサービスとして公開するためのコマンドです。このコマンドを実行すると、hello-worldという名前のデプロイメントが外部からアクセス可能なサービスとして公開されます。

上記のコマンドで起動したデプロイメントにアクセスする方法を教えてください
(略)次に、以下のコマンドを実行します。
zsh$ kubectl get services
このコマンドを実行すると、Kubernetes上で公開されているサービスの一覧が表示されます。
上記のサンプルコードでは、 hello-world
という名前のサービスが作成されているため、そのサービスが表示されます。
表示された一覧から、hello-worldという名前のサービスのエンドポイントを確認します。エンドポイントは、以下のような形式で表示されます
なるほど

ほんとか?

w

zshhttp://<IP Address>:<Port>
上記のエンドポイントをWebブラウザーなどでアクセスすることで、hello-worldという名前のサービスにアクセスすることができます。